Output e90d8124753538914d37dddb394b1ee6dc07a17bcb40b1d69e9e6bef2aca3108:0

value
398951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74e6c3c5037bbdd6c555850f233a24ff99b4acd2 OP_EQUAL
address
3CM8kcMBGjxvHus2tR6bjvbSwDfu2rcdoj
transaction
e90d8124753538914d37dddb394b1ee6dc07a17bcb40b1d69e9e6bef2aca3108